About this trial

The purpose of this study is to evaluate the efficacy and safety of sugemalimab (CS1001) in combination with PGemOx regimen (pegaspargase, gemcitabine, oxaliplatin) in treatment of adult patients with Extranodal NK/T-Cell Lymphoma (ENKTL) who have relapsed or become refractory to asparaginase-based regimens.

Eligibility criteria

Qualifiers

Has ENKTL histologically confirmed by the study center. Nasal and non-nasal ENKTL are both allowed.

Has relapsed or refractory ENKTL after prior asparaginase-based chemotherapy or chemoradiotherapy.

Has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group (ECOG) performance status score of 0-2.

Has at least one measurable lesion per Lugano 2014 classification.

Disqualifiers

Has aggressive natural killer-cell leukemia, current central nervous system (CNS) involvement or is concomitant with hemophagocytic lymphohistiocytosis.

Has known additional malignancy within 5 years prior to randomization.

Has an active autoimmune disease or has had an autoimmune disease that may relapse.

Has had a major surgical procedure within 28 days or radiotherapy within 90 days before the first dose of study treatment.
